We don’t know much more about the new wine bar coming to Ditmars since we last reported, except that the owners are hoping to open before the end of November.

Also, signage is up and looks stylish. What do you think that ‘O’ represents? A scale? For charcuterie and cheese? On which one could measure a ‘kilo’-gram of food?
This is an exciting opening because it’s owned by the people at Adega Wine and Spirits next door. The shop is so nice inside, is super well-reviewed online, and features so many free tastings. I have a feeling that Astoria wine lovers are going to be very happy with this place…
